Mandatory E-Filing for CESTAT Appeals – Effective November 10, 2025

The Customs, Excise and Service Tax Appellate Tribunal (CESTAT) issued Circular No. F. No. 01(05)/Circular/CESTAT/2025 dated October 1, 2025, as per which all appeals and applications before the Tribunal must be filed online from November 15, 2025.

Key Dates and Important Changes

  • Go-Live Date: The new e-filing system comes into effect on November 15, 2025.
  • Physical Filing Discontinued: Physical filing of appeals will be discontinued as of December 31, 2025.
  • Where to File: New appeals and applications must be filed online in PDF format and signed by the Appellant by logging into https://efiling.cestat.gov.in.
  • Limitation Period: Appeals filed online and complete in all respects will be deemed presented on the date the diary number is generated for the purpose of limitation.
  • Fee Payment: Applicable fees can be paid either through online or offline mode, with all payments accepted via the Bharat Kosh payment gateway.
  • Respondent Filings: Applications/Memorandum of Cross Objection filed by the Respondent must also be filed online.

Action Required for Existing/Pending Appeals

All assessees/taxpayers must upload documents for all pending appeals that were filed earlier, whether by themselves or through consultants/advocates, as part of this e-filing drive.

Here is the process for uploading old appeals:

  1. Register/Login: Users must first register themselves with the e-filing portal. If you already provided your e-mail ID, use it to log in. If not, you must contact the respective registry to add your e-mail ID, mobile number, and other details to the database.
  2. View List: Once logged in, the list of previously filed appeals will be visible under the “Document filing” sub-menu.
  1. Upload Documents: You are required to select each appeal and go to “select document type” to upload all documents, including the appeal memo. No document filed earlier should be left out.
  1. Deadline for Upload: Uploading of all old appeals must be completed at the earliest, but not later than one week before the date of the final hearing of the appeal or hearing of an application filed therein.

Important Note: The documents selected and uploaded will be the only ones available at the time of the hearing. Any new document omitted earlier may be uploaded only with the leave of the respective bench on a proper application.
